I make a lot of venison jersey, some goose and some beef. Here's the thing. I'll use a couple of venison roasts, make two full gallon bags of jersey. It's two days of marinating and two days of dehydrating. Then my kids and I devour it in like three weeks.

It's way cheaper to make your own but time consuming if you eat a lot of for a rtwo pound roast.
2 cups soy sauce
1 cup worchestershire
2 tablespoons liquid smoke
Quarter cup red chili flakes
1 cup orange juice
Two tablespoons minced garlic
Mix all those for the marinade. Slice the meat to 1/4 inch slices. Marinate sliced meat for two days. Then dehydrate in a dehydrator. Mine is the Ronco model but any will do.
